On Tuesday, September 15, 2009, at 1:00 p.m. in room 2123 of the Rayburn House Office Building, the full Committee held a hearing entitled "Preparing for the 2009 Pandemic Flu." The purpose of the hearing was to learn what is known about this novel influenza strain, what the nation can expect in terms of a surge in cases of H1N1 influenza, and what steps the Department of Health and Human Services has taken and is planning on taking to respond to the surge in cases.
